Output 379beb352ab44374029a22585016ecb8a8f078454bf75b64e7a1322630cda6c3:5

value
1039970
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0418e8da9c77129d5f54370205cbde6a325c8377 OP_EQUALVERIFY OP_CHECKSIG
address
1NfYWuka3EMfLbpfsYx6ugmBJVo7CZgJH
transaction
379beb352ab44374029a22585016ecb8a8f078454bf75b64e7a1322630cda6c3
spent
true